Salesforce trades at a forward price-to-earnings ratio of 12 after beating earnings per share estimates by 24 percent, yet the stock has fallen 37 percent year to date. Palantir’s trailing P/E of 145 and price-to-sales multiple of 59 price in perfection while the stock sits 25 percent lower year to date. Salesforce’s Agentforce annual recurring revenue surged 205 percent year over year to 1.2 billion dollars, matching Palantir’s AI growth narrative at a fraction of the valuation. Salesforce returned 27.5 billion dollars to shareholders in the first quarter, anchored by a 25-billion-dollar accelerated share repurchase, and posted free cash flow of 6.556 billion dollars in a single quarter. The company’s combined Agentforce and Data 360 annual recurring revenue reached nearly 3.4 billion dollars, up more than 200 percent, with current remaining performance obligation of 33.6 billion dollars.
